The RZFD-330F square bottom paper bag machine with flat handle inline is designed around the continuous production requirements of medium-size handle paper bags. It integrates flat handle processing and square bottom paper bag forming within the same operating system, allowing the paper and handle materials to follow a unified processing path inside the machine. Before the roll paper enters the forming section, top edge processing and pre-positioning of the handle structure are already completed, reducing interference from overlapping processes during subsequent bag forming and simplifying the traditional segmented production method from the perspective of production organization. In actual operation, this integrated processing method is more conducive to maintaining a stable production rhythm and also helps enterprises achieve continuous output in the production of medium-size handle paper bags.
In terms of the connection between the handle structure and the bag body, the machine applies continuous control to the flat handle feeding, positioning, and bonding processes, allowing the handles to achieve uniform load distribution during attachment. The top edge area is further stabilized during the pressing process, providing a reliable bonding foundation for the handle structure and allowing the bag body to maintain integrity during carrying. The paper feeding and cutting stages are kept under stable control, so that the bag opening and edges remain neat, reducing detail variations caused by material fluctuation. Under continuous production conditions, this connection method from front-end positioning to back-end forming helps reduce adjustment frequency and improve finished product consistency.
At the equipment operation and maintenance level, the control system centrally manages parameters related to bag specifications and handles, making unified adjustment convenient during changeovers between different orders. The machine adopts a modular zoned structure, allowing each unit to be handled independently during maintenance and reducing the impact on overall production. In structural design, the machine takes long-term operating requirements into account, and key components are optimized for durability and stability so that it can adapt to continuous production environments. Through the coordinated optimization of process flow and structure, the machine is more suitable as a stable operating unit in the production of medium-size paper bags with flat handle, keeping the production process controllable and efficient while ensuring finished product quality.
